MARY SCHLEUSNER | WASHINGTON AND LEE | SO. | F | CHARLOTTE, N.C.
Schleusner, a sophomore from Charlotte, N.C., continues to ramp up her game with the season winding down as she racked up one more double-double to lead #23 Washington and Lee to a pair of ODAC wins to improve to 15-1 in conference play and 21-2 overall atop the league table. Schleusner scored 52 points and pulled down 34 rebounds in 49 total minutes on the floor while shooting 62.9 percent (22-of-35) from the field. In a 109-54 victory over Averett, Schleusner registered 26 points on 10-of-16 from the field and 6-of-6 from the line. She added nine rebounds, two assists, two steals, and four blocked shots to her line in a 22 minute shift. On the weekend, Schleusner set a new WLU women's basketball record with 25 rebounds to go with 26 points in 27 minutes in a 75-58 victory over Randolph-Macon. Her 25 rebounds mark the third-highest total corralled by one player in Division III this season and are three shy of the ODAC record set by former RMC standout Katie Anderson. Schleusner was 12-of-19 from the field against the Yellow Jackets and added three assists, a steal, and four blocked shots. She is currently tied for second in the country with 18 doubles. She leads Division III in defensive rebounding (9.9) and ranks second total rebounding (14.9) and overall rebounds (343). She is fourth in field goals made (212) and blocked shots (74), seventh in points (521), and 10th in scoring (22.7).
